<p>Pumpkins are iconic symbols of autumn and Halloween, representing abundance, transformation, and the harvest. Beyond their festive appeal, pumpkins can be powerful tools for divination, particularly in the practice of scrying. Scrying is a form of divination that involves gazing into a reflective or translucent surface to receive visions or insights. Using pumpkins for scrying combines the seasonal magic of autumn with ancient divination practices. Here’s how you can harness the mystical energy of pumpkins for scrying.</p>
<h3>Preparing for Pumpkin Scrying</h3>
<h4>1. Choosing Your Pumpkin</h4>
<ul>
<li><strong>Select a Medium-Sized Pumpkin</strong>: Choose a pumpkin that is round, with a smooth, flat surface on one side. This will provide a stable base for your scrying surface.</li>
<li><strong>Check for Freshness</strong>: Ensure the pumpkin is fresh and free from rot or damage.</li>
</ul>
<h4>2. Creating Your Scrying Surface</h4>
<ul>
<li><strong>Hollow Out the Pumpkin</strong>: Cut off the top of the pumpkin and scoop out the seeds and pulp. Save the seeds for roasting or planting, and compost the rest.</li>
<li><strong>Smooth the Interior</strong>: Scrape the interior walls until they are smooth. This helps to create a clean surface for your scrying medium.</li>
<li><strong>Cut a Flat Surface</strong>: If needed, cut a flat section on the side of the pumpkin to create a stable base.</li>
</ul>
<h3>Techniques for Pumpkin Scrying</h3>
<h4>1. Water Scrying</h4>
<p>Water scrying involves using the reflective surface of water to receive visions and insights.</p>
<p><strong>Steps</strong>:</p>
<ol>
<li><strong>Fill the Pumpkin with Water</strong>: Pour clean water into the hollowed-out pumpkin, filling it to about three-quarters full.</li>
<li><strong>Create a Reflective Surface</strong>: For added effect, place a small mirror or a piece of reflective foil at the bottom of the pumpkin before adding water. This enhances the reflective quality of the water.</li>
<li><strong>Set Up Your Space</strong>: Place the pumpkin on a stable surface. Light candles around the pumpkin to create a soft, ambient glow. You may also burn incense to enhance the atmosphere.</li>
<li><strong>Focus Your Mind</strong>: Sit comfortably in front of the pumpkin. Take a few deep breaths to center yourself and clear your mind.</li>
<li><strong>Gaze into the Water</strong>: Look into the surface of the water, allowing your gaze to soften. Don’t force any images to appear; simply observe and remain open to any visions or impressions.</li>
<li><strong>Interpret Your Visions</strong>: Take note of any shapes, symbols, or scenes that appear in the water. Trust your intuition to interpret their meanings.</li>
</ol>
<h4>2. Candle Flame Scrying</h4>
<p>Candle flame scrying uses the flickering flame of a candle as a focus for divination.</p>
<p><strong>Steps</strong>:</p>
<ol>
<li><strong>Prepare the Pumpkin</strong>: Hollow out the pumpkin and place a small candle inside. Ensure the candle is secure and won’t tip over.</li>
<li><strong>Light the Candle</strong>: Light the candle and place the top back on the pumpkin, leaving the flame visible through the opening.</li>
<li><strong>Set Up Your Space</strong>: Dim the lights or perform this scrying in a darkened room. The flickering candlelight should be the primary source of illumination.</li>
<li><strong>Focus on the Flame</strong>: Sit comfortably and focus on the flickering flame inside the pumpkin. Let your mind relax and become receptive.</li>
<li><strong>Observe the Flame</strong>: Watch how the flame moves, flickers, and changes shape. Allow your mind to drift and be open to any images or thoughts that come.</li>
<li><strong>Interpret Your Observations</strong>: Reflect on the movements and shapes of the flame. Consider how they relate to your question or situation.</li>
</ol>
<h4>3. Mirror Scrying</h4>
<p>Mirror scrying involves using a mirror as a reflective surface to receive visions.</p>
<p><strong>Steps</strong>:</p>
<ol>
<li><strong>Prepare the Pumpkin</strong>: Hollow out the pumpkin and cut a large, smooth section from one side to create a window. Place a small mirror inside the pumpkin, angled towards the window.</li>
<li><strong>Light Candles</strong>: Place candles around the pumpkin to create a soft, flickering light that reflects off the mirror.</li>
<li><strong>Focus Your Mind</strong>: Sit comfortably in front of the pumpkin and mirror setup. Take deep breaths to center yourself.</li>
<li><strong>Gaze into the Mirror</strong>: Look into the mirror, allowing your gaze to soften and become unfocused. Be open to any images or impressions that arise.</li>
<li><strong>Interpret Your Visions</strong>: Note any symbols, shapes, or scenes you see in the mirror. Use your intuition to interpret their significance.</li>
</ol>
<h3>Enhancing Your Scrying Practice</h3>
<h4>1. Set Intentions</h4>
<p>Before beginning your scrying session, set clear intentions. What do you seek to know or understand? Focus your mind on this question or intention.</p>
<h4>2. Use Sacred Space</h4>
<p>Create a sacred space for your scrying practice. This can include lighting candles, burning incense, and placing crystals or other magical items around your scrying area.</p>
<h4>3. Keep a Journal</h4>
<p>Keep a scrying journal to record your experiences, visions, and interpretations. This can help you track patterns and deepen your understanding of your scrying practice.</p>
<h4>4. Practice Regularly</h4>
<p>Like any skill, scrying improves with practice. Set aside regular time for scrying sessions to develop your abilities and deepen your connection with the practice.</p>

<p class="wp-block-paragraph">In the world of divination and mysticism, scrying is a practice that has intrigued and captivated seekers of the unknown for centuries. It&#8217;s a method of gazing into reflective surfaces to tap into the subconscious, gain insights, and unveil hidden truths. Scrying mirrors and bowls, with their enigmatic allure, have been instrumental in this mystical art. Join us on a journey into the fascinating world of scrying, where the mystical unknown beckons.</p>



<h2 class="wp-block-heading">The Art of Scrying</h2>



<h3 class="wp-block-heading">Understanding Scrying</h3>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">Scrying is a divination technique that involves gazing into a reflective or translucent surface to access deeper levels of consciousness and receive intuitive or clairvoyant information. The act of scrying is ancient, dating back to civilizations like the Egyptians and the ancient Greeks.</p>



<h3 class="wp-block-heading">Various Scrying Tools</h3>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">While scrying can be done with various tools, scrying mirrors and bowls have held a prominent place in this mystical practice. These instruments provide a canvas for the mind to project images, symbols, and visions during the scrying process.</p>



<h2 class="wp-block-heading">Scrying Mirrors: Portals to the Subconscious</h2>



<h3 class="wp-block-heading">The Nature of Scrying Mirrors</h3>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">Scrying mirrors are typically black, though they can also be made from darkened glass. The deep, reflective surface serves as a portal to the subconscious mind, allowing the practitioner to peer into the realms of intuition and hidden knowledge.</p>



<h3 class="wp-block-heading">How to Use a Scrying Mirror</h3>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">Using a scrying mirror involves softening your gaze, relaxing your mind, and allowing images, symbols, or impressions to arise naturally. It&#8217;s a practice of receptivity, where the subconscious communicates through the reflective surface.</p>



<h2 class="wp-block-heading">Scrying Bowls: Vessels of Perception</h2>



<h3 class="wp-block-heading">The Significance of Scrying Bowls</h3>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">Scrying bowls are often filled with water or other translucent substances. The water&#8217;s surface acts as a receptive medium, mirroring the subconscious mind&#8217;s images and insights. Scrying bowls have a long history in various cultures, from ancient Rome to Indigenous traditions.</p>



<h3 class="wp-block-heading">The Ritual of Scrying Bowls</h3>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">To scry with a bowl, the practitioner typically stares into the water&#8217;s surface, allowing the mind to enter a receptive, meditative state. The images that emerge are interpreted for their symbolic or intuitive significance.</p>



<h2 class="wp-block-heading">The Magic of Scrying</h2>



<h3 class="wp-block-heading">Personal Connection</h3>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">The practice of scrying is highly personal, as it relies on the individual&#8217;s intuitive and psychic abilities. It&#8217;s a journey into the depths of one&#8217;s own consciousness, where the veil between the conscious and the unconscious is thin.</p>



<h3 class="wp-block-heading">Symbolism and Interpretation</h3>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">Interpreting scrying visions requires intuition and a deep connection to symbolism. What may seem like random shapes or patterns to an observer can hold profound meaning to the scryer.</p>
